Nestled in the vineyard, Bruma Wine Resort offers a sophisticated retreat. Savor wine at the tasting room or winery tours, then unwind with a meal at one of two on-site restaurants and relax by the fireplace in the lobby.

About this property

Bruma Wine Resort

When visiting Valle de Guadalupe, Bruma Wine Resort is a great choice to consider. After splashing around at one of the 2 outdoor pools, you can visit one of the 2 restaurants for a bite to eat, or unwind with a drink at one of the 3 bars/lounges. Other highlights at this Tuscan hotel include a health club, a fitness center, and an outdoor tennis court.

Policies

The property has connecting/adjoining rooms, which are subject to availability and can be requested by contacting the property using the number on the booking confirmation.
Only registered guests are allowed in the guestrooms.
Some facilities may have restricted access. Guests can contact the property for details using the contact information on the booking confirmation.
This property does not have elevators.
This property uses solar energy, plus a grey water recycling system.
Guests can rest easy knowing there's a fire extinguisher, a smoke detector, a security system, a first aid kit, and outdoor lighting on site.

Pretty but not amazing
Lovely room, but for the price, the touches aren't quite all there. We booked this hotel because we were dining at Fauna, their exemplary restaurant, the first night of our trip. Turns out Fauna is so far on the other end of the property that we still had to drive, kind of defeating the purpose of staying at Bruma in the first place. Room was very nice with a comfy bed, but a little lacking beyond that. The lighting in the room and especially in the bathroom are EXTREMELY dim, so it was difficult to see and almost impossible to get dressed and do makeup. Loved the shower, though. No TV or seating in the bedroom, which isn't that big a deal, but the light from the AC unit shines right at your face all night long. Our AC remote broke so we couldn't turn it off and were freezing cold all night, too. No phone in the room, so we couldn't call the concierge to let them know. The door to the room banged all night with the wind; we pushed our luggage against it to keep it in place, which sort of worked. And the construction on the property started right outside our balcony doors at 8 am sharp, so no sleeping in, either. All in all, Bruma has some lovely touches and incredible food, but for the price, I wouldn't stay here again.

8/10 Very good

Overall we had a great time, but it didn’t start off well. As a couple reviewers noted, we weren’t aware that there are three hotels on this property and, of course, we booked the one that doesn’t have a pool (Atico). I think this information needs to be more explicit on Expedia's site (and on the hotel's website as well) and/or in the booking because we were very disappointed when we discovered our error. Thankfully, we talked with the staff and they were kind enough to hook us up with daily access to one of the pools for a nominal fee. Problem solved. We had to drive to it every day because it’s a sprawling property, but it was easy. Plus the pool is worth it; It’s small but refreshing and in the middle of a beautiful vineyard, flanked by a massive oak tree. The friendly staff supplied us with all the wine we wanted. It was never crowded - one day we had the pool completely to ourselves. The only other negative was: lots of stairs. Our room was on the second floor and even the bed in the room was in a loft. We brought our two dachshunds, so we were carrying dogs up and down stairs a lot. I actually appreciated the exercise, but be prepared for stairs - there were no ground floor rooms or elevators at Atico. Overall, it’s a lovely property, the staff is super friendly, the restaurants on site are really good (Fauna definitely deserves their “Best Restaurant Mexico 2023” award from 50 Best), and their Ocho wine label puts out some delicious wines.
